BRAKE FLUID DRAINING
Front brake
:
Turn the handlebar until the reservoir is parallel to the
ground
.
Remove the following :
-
Screws [ 1 ]
-
Reservoir cover
[ 2 ]
-
Set plate [ 3 ]
-
Diaphragm
[ 4
]
;
Rear brake :
Support the motorcycle in an upright position
.
Remove the bolt [
1
] , reservoir cover [ 2 ] and rear master
cylinder
reservoir [
3 ]
.
Temporarily install the reservoir and mounting bolt
to
the stay .
Remove the cover cap [
4 ]
,
set plate [ 5 ] and diaphragm
[ 6 ]
,
:
Connect
a bleed hose [
1 ] to the caliper bleed valve [ 2 ]
.
Loosen the bleed valve and pump the brake lever / pedal
until no more fluid flows out of the bleed valve
.
BRAKE FLUID FILLING/ AIR BLEEDING
Do not
mix
different
Fill the reservoir with DOT
4 brake fluid from a sealed
types of fluid ; they
container .
are not compatible
.
Connect a automatic refill system to the reservoir
.
If an automatic refill system is not used
,
add
fluid
when
the fluid level in the reservoir is low .
Check the fluid level often while bleeding the brake
to prevent
air
from
being pumped into the system .
• When using
a brake
bleeding tool
,
follow
the
manufacturer '
s
operating instructions
.
